Kidnappers Kill Jigawa ADC Governorship Aspirant After Collecting ₦75 Million Ransom

Kidnappers have reportedly killed Jigawa ADC governorship aspirant, Alhaji Hon. Abba Anas Adamu Laushi, along the Kaduna-Abuja highway days after abducting him while travelling to purchase his nomination form.

He was kidnapped last Friday alongside Ali Tukur Gantsa after they were intercepted by armed men. The abductors later demanded ₦75 million for their release. While “Ali Tukur Gantsa managed to escape,” the kidnappers allegedly “tragically killed” Hon. Abba Anas even after receiving the ransom payment. His body is currently being conveyed to Kano for burial arrangements.

Abba Anas was a former member of the House of Representatives who served between 2007 and 2011, representing the Birniwa, Guri, and Kirikasamma Federal Constituency of Jigawa State. Before his death, he was contesting for the Jigawa State governorship under the African Democratic Congress, ADC.

Family members and associates described the incident as devastating, saying he lost his life “at the hands of these heartless criminals while on a journey to fulfill his political aspirations.” They prayed for Almighty Allah to forgive him and grant him eternal rest.
